Innocent growth the result of marketing

Marketing Week reports drinks maker Innocent has hailed marketing as playing a vital role in growing the size of the company by 20% in value last year. Innocent, where Coca-Cola has the majority stake in the company is now the largest smoothie brand in Europe and grew in value to £135m, from £112m in 2009, [...]

TV campaign to launch Toffee Dodgers

VCCP is launching a new TV campaign to launch Toffee Dodgers, the new flavour from the number one kids’ biscuit, Jammie Dodgers. The campaign breaks on 1st May with TV, online and point of sale. Greggs marketers shift focus to tactical social media

Marketing Week reports that Sandwich chain Greggs plans to switch to tactical marketing activity as it seeks to become the UK’s biggest sandwich and savouries outlet. The company will focus on tactical radio, press, social media and local store activity for the rest of 2011. The shift follows the brand-building campaign launched in 2010 that [...]
